any wireing guru's around??? OK I have a 2001 M6 TA that didn't have TCS. I installed a QTEC and they said use the harness pink wire (TCS wire harness) for switched hot and a ground. I used the black with white stripe on the same harness. Since this install I haven't been able to connect with EFILive and just got LS1Edit - no connect either. On LS1Edit I read that I'm supposed to get a green led in the module to show its connected to the PCM - no lights at all. Question is that did I somehow disable the connection port from using that harness??? With the QTEC whenever the ignition is on the toggle switch is lit - maybe pulling power through that circuit locks out the OBD II connection port??? Anyone know before I start re-wiring? |
Re: any wireing guru's around??? The 2 things don't sound related. It sounds like for some reason you have lost the 12 volt battery feed to pin 16 of the diagnostic connector. That is an orange wire that comes straight from the battery thru fuse 11 I think (CIG/ACC FUSE). I'd check that first. Your QTEC wiring sounds ok. |
Re: any wireing guru's around??? I put a 2000 LS1 in a mid-engine Sandrail and have retained the DLC connector. I have it wired as follows. Pin 16 - Hot all the time Pin 5 - Black/White Ground Pin 4 - Black Ground Pin 2 - PPL Serial Data Line My Diablo Hellion scanner comes on when I plug it in, but the switch must be on to get any readings. <small>[ December 21, 2002, 04:55 PM: Message edited by: Dipstick ]</small> |
Re: any wireing guru's around??? Thx Speartech - fuse 11 it was - blown sometime. replaced and all works - connects AOK now! |
